Lukashenko expresses condolences to Vahagn Khachaturyan over soldiers' deaths in barracks fire
The President of Belarus, Alexander Lukashenko, has expressed his condolences to the President of Armenia, Vahagn Khachaturyan, following the deaths of individuals in a fire at one of the military bases.
"I received the news about the fire that broke out in one of the Armenian Ministry of Defense's military units with sadness, which resulted in the deaths of servicemen," the condolence telegram states.
According to a statement released by the press service of the Belarusian President, Lukashenko extended sincere condolences to the families and loved ones of the deceased on behalf of the people of Belarus and himself, wishing a swift recovery to all affected by this tragic incident.
